Cultivating Eco-Friendly Nanomaterials: Mimosa Pudica-Enhanced Zinc Oxide Nanoparticles for Enhanced Health and Environmental Well-being

G.K. Prashanth,
Srilatha Rao,
Manoj Gadewar
et al.

Abstract: In this work, we report the development of ZnO NPs by using environmentally friendly SCS using Mimosa pudica (MP) leaves. The obtained ZnO-MP-NPs were subjected to extensive characterization techniques such as PXRD, BET, SEM, & TEM. Further, ZnO-MP-NPs were evaluated for their antioxidant ability by DPPH method. Their anticancer capability was assessed by MTT assay on human breast cancer cell ine MCF-7. The results indicated the potential applications of ZnO-MP-NPs both as antioxidant and anticancer agents.
